selenium - 如何通过“场景大纲示例”传递双引号
问题描述
如何通过 Cucumber Scenario Outline Example 传递双引号,当我在 Example 中键入双引号时,Scenario 步骤将处于非活动状态。在下面的场景中username"1
,我无法通过。任何人都建议如何通过场景大纲传递双引号,谢谢。
Scenario Outline:Login detail
And I enter "<username>" and "<password>"
Example:
| username | password |
| username"1 | password1 |
| username2 | password2 |
解决方案
您可以尝试使用反斜杠(即 )转义双引号。请查看下面的 gif,它显示了它是如何使用 NoCodeBDD 完成的。但是,我相信,在 Cucumber 等其他基于脚本的工具中也应该如此。
https://nocodebdd.live/examples-with-double-quotes
免责声明:我创建此产品是为了加快 BDD 的自动化,而无需编写任何代码。我很想从社区获得一些关于产品的反馈。您可以从https://www.nocodedd.com/download下载免费版本
推荐阅读
- c++ - 为什么我输入了 66,第二个数字却是 0?
- python - pandas:如何将行合并为单行
- report - 如何在文档示例中包含报告的“配置”面板?
- azure - Azure VM 启动/停止日志
- sql-server - HASHBYTES SHA2-256 函数生成的列的 SSIS 违反主键约束错误
- python - 如何让函数记住 python 迭代器停止的最后位置?
- java - 为什么 JProfiler 在 Java 中向我显示每个 char[] 200+ 字节的巨大开销?
- swift - SwiftUI 如何从另一个类访问 ContentView 变量
- python - 你能帮我理解这个熊猫代码吗
- javascript - Chrome 扩展:我需要开发工具网络选项卡日志。那可能吗?